Overview
The ASTM C136 - Sieve Analysis of Aggregates worksheet can be used to determine the particle size distribution of fine and coarse aggregates. It is based on the methodology of the ASTM Standard Test Method for Sieve Analysis of Fine and Coarse Aggregates (C136/C136M).
The standard structure and functionality of this worksheet is described in the article Particle Size Distribution by Sieving Tests and its related articles. This article focuses on those parts of the worksheet where the functionality varies from, or is additional to, the standard functionality.
Together, these articles provide information on how the various choices available within the QEST Web App version of this test method provide the required pathways to deal with the variations within the test.

Material Washed
Material Washed
This functionality is essentially the same as for the standard Sieve Analysis Specimen Preparation, Received Sample Condition, Nominal Particle Size, Timing of Drying, Timing of Washing | Timing of Washing .
The difference is that instead of having an in-built Washing section, this worksheet uses an embedded version of ASTM C117 to implement the washing process.
Selecting a washing option causes the embedded test to be added to the worksheet.

Classification Table
Description | Size Range (mm) | |
---|---|---|
Cobbles (and Boulders) | >3” (>75.0) | |
Gravel | Coarse | 3” to ¾” (75.0 to 19.0) |
Fine | ¾” to #4 (19.0 to 4.75) | |
Sand | Coarse | #4 to #10 (4.75 to 2.00) |
Medium | #10 to #40 (2.00 to 0.425) | |
Fine | #40 to #200 (0.425 to 0.075) | |
Fines | Silt and Clay | <#200 (< 0.075) |
The boundaries used for the material classification table are consistent with ASTM D2487.
Additional Results
The following calculated results are normally reported, if all requirements are met:
Percentile Values - D10, D15, D30, D50, D60, D85:
Coefficient of Uniformity (Cu);
Coefficient of Curvature (Cc).
Optional Results
The following value is normally available for optional reporting, if all requirements are met:
Fineness Modulus (Fm).

Work Progress and Complete Status
The work progress rules noted below are the default set of rules for this test, these may be overwritten by system administrators and therefore behave differently on each QEST Platform instance.
Progress (%) | Criteria |
---|---|
0% | Test has been registered |
30% | Specimen Wet Mass has a non-zero value |
50% | Specimen Dry Mass has a valid non-zero value |
100% | Test is complete |
